§ 44-7-2440 — Annual reports and quarterly bulletins; contents; publicizing of reports.

South Carolina·Title 44 HEALTH·Ch. 7 HOSPITALS, TUBERCULOSIS CAMPS, AND HEALTH SERVICES DISTRICTS
(A)The department annually shall submit to the General Assembly a report summarizing the hospital reports submitted pursuant to Section 44-7-2430 and shall publish the annual report on its website. The first annual report must be submitted and published before February 1, 2009. Subsequent annual reports to the General Assembly must be submitted before April sixteenth of each year. The department may issue quarterly informational bulletins summarizing all or part of the information submitted in the hospital reports.
(B)All reports issued by the department must be risk adjusted.

Legislative History

HISTORY: 2006 Act No. 293, SECTION 1, eff May 31, 2006; 2008 Act No. 353, SECTION 2, Pt 5.E.1, eff July 1, 2008; 2010 Act No. 165, SECTION 2, eff May 11, 2010.
